Skip to content

Commit ac85db9

Browse files
committed
Added splitstring cli
1 parent aebbbe1 commit ac85db9

File tree

2 files changed

+9
-2
lines changed

2 files changed

+9
-2
lines changed

Makefile

Lines changed: 8 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@ VERSION = $(shell grep -m1 'Version = ' $(PROJECT).go | cut -d\` -f 2)
77

88
BRANCH = $(shell git branch | grep '* ' | cut -d\ -f 2)
99

10-
build: bin/csvcols bin/csvrows bin/csvfind bin/csvjoin bin/jsoncols bin/jsonrange bin/xlsx2json bin/xlsx2csv bin/csv2mdtable bin/csv2xlsx bin/csv2json bin/vcard2json bin/jsonjoin bin/jsonmunge bin/findfile bin/finddir bin/mergepath bin/reldate bin/range bin/timefmt bin/urlparse
10+
build: bin/csvcols bin/csvrows bin/csvfind bin/csvjoin bin/jsoncols bin/jsonrange bin/xlsx2json bin/xlsx2csv bin/csv2mdtable bin/csv2xlsx bin/csv2json bin/vcard2json bin/jsonjoin bin/jsonmunge bin/findfile bin/finddir bin/mergepath bin/reldate bin/range bin/timefmt bin/urlparse bin/splitstring
1111

1212

1313
bin/csvcols: datatools.go cmds/csvcols/csvcols.go
@@ -73,6 +73,8 @@ bin/timefmt: datatools.go cmds/timefmt/timefmt.go
7373
bin/urlparse: datatools.go cmds/urlparse/urlparse.go
7474
go build -o bin/urlparse cmds/urlparse/urlparse.go
7575

76+
bin/splitstring: datatools.go cmds/splitstring/splitstring.go
77+
go build -o bin/splitstring cmds/splitstring/splitstring.go
7678

7779
test:
7880
go test
@@ -121,6 +123,7 @@ install:
121123
env GOBIN=$(GOPATH)/bin go install cmds/vcard2json/vcard2json.go
122124
env GOBIN=$(GOPATH)/bin go install cmds/xlsx2json/xlsx2json.go
123125
env GOBIN=$(GOPATH)/bin go install cmds/xlsx2csv/xlsx2csv.go
126+
env GOBIN=$(GOPATH)/bin go install cmds/splitstring/splitstring.go
124127

125128
dist/linux-amd64:
126129
mkdir -p dist/bin
@@ -145,6 +148,7 @@ dist/linux-amd64:
145148
env GOOS=linux GOARCH=amd64 go build -o dist/bin/range cmds/range/range.go
146149
env GOOS=linux GOARCH=amd64 go build -o dist/bin/timefmt cmds/timefmt/timefmt.go
147150
env GOOS=linux GOARCH=amd64 go build -o dist/bin/urlparse cmds/urlparse/urlparse.go
151+
env GOOS=linux GOARCH=amd64 go build -o dist/bin/splitstring cmds/splitstring/splitstring.go
148152
cd dist && zip -r $(PROJECT)-$(VERSION)-linux-amd64.zip README.md LICENSE INSTALL.md bin/* docs/* how-to/* demos/*
149153
rm -fR dist/bin
150154

@@ -172,6 +176,7 @@ dist/macosx-amd64:
172176
env GOOS=darwin GOARCH=amd64 go build -o dist/bin/range cmds/range/range.go
173177
env GOOS=darwin GOARCH=amd64 go build -o dist/bin/timefmt cmds/timefmt/timefmt.go
174178
env GOOS=darwin GOARCH=amd64 go build -o dist/bin/urlparse cmds/urlparse/urlparse.go
179+
env GOOS=darwin GOARCH=amd64 go build -o dist/bin/splitstring cmds/splitstring/splitstring.go
175180
cd dist && zip -r $(PROJECT)-$(VERSION)-macosx-amd64.zip README.md LICENSE INSTALL.md bin/* docs/* how-to/* demos/*
176181
rm -fR dist/bin
177182

@@ -200,6 +205,7 @@ dist/windows-amd64:
200205
env GOOS=windows GOARCH=amd64 go build -o dist/bin/range.exe cmds/range/range.go
201206
env GOOS=windows GOARCH=amd64 go build -o dist/bin/timefmt.exe cmds/timefmt/timefmt.go
202207
env GOOS=windows GOARCH=amd64 go build -o dist/bin/urlparse.exe cmds/urlparse/urlparse.go
208+
env GOOS=windows GOARCH=amd64 go build -o dist/bin/splitstring.exe cmds/splitstring/splitstring.go
203209
cd dist && zip -r $(PROJECT)-$(VERSION)-windows-amd64.zip README.md LICENSE INSTALL.md bin/* docs/* how-to/* demos/*
204210
rm -fR dist/bin
205211

@@ -229,6 +235,7 @@ dist/raspbian-arm7:
229235
env GOOS=linux GOARCH=arm GOARM=7 go build -o dist/bin/range cmds/range/range.go
230236
env GOOS=linux GOARCH=arm GOARM=7 go build -o dist/bin/timefmt cmds/timefmt/timefmt.go
231237
env GOOS=linux GOARCH=arm GOARM=7 go build -o dist/bin/urlparse cmds/urlparse/urlparse.go
238+
env GOOS=linux GOARCH=arm GOARM=7 go build -o dist/bin/splitstring cmds/splitstring/splitstring.go
232239
cd dist && zip -r $(PROJECT)-$(VERSION)-raspbian-arm7.zip README.md LICENSE INSTALL.md bin/* docs/* how-to/* demos/*
233240
rm -fR dist/bin
234241

datatools.go

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-35,7 +35,7 @@ import (
3535
)
3636

3737
const (
38-
Version = `v0.0.15`
38+
Version = `v0.0.16-dev`
3939

4040
LicenseText = `
4141
%s %s

0 commit comments

Comments
 (0)